Output 8ca8343ec390185ec20019f557721f7b9b5468df4b1afb52b8941c4763feca94:7

value
1397971258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5ae4a6df9b6e3a1146a7547ff8e9885e9a8a3d5 OP_EQUAL
address
3Q64GUWhvYLhMYg4D8STjoF38JVdDerUSZ
transaction
8ca8343ec390185ec20019f557721f7b9b5468df4b1afb52b8941c4763feca94
spent
true